A classic piece of roadside Americana, Cadillac Ranch is a public art installation near Amarillo, Texas.
It was created in 1974 by the New Orleans art group Ant Farm, who half-buried 10 Cadillacs nose-first in the Texan soil. Amarillo is renowned for the Is This the Way song by Tony Christie, and Cadillac Ranch was a Bruce Springsteen single.
But if you want to impress your friends, tell them Amarillo was known as the Helium Capital of the World. Tell them in a squeaky voice...
